I've lived in my home for 45 days now, and am generally satisfied overall; however, there are some items to note if you're going into a home buying experience here. Make sure you know your colorways and are happy with them prior to agreeing to purchase the home. Don't let the salespeople, construction team, warranty people, or anyone force you into anything. For the price paid for the home, the construction was reasonable and workmanship was okay.. but you'd expect more attention to detail and prompt follow-up to correct minor issues and ensure the customer is happy. Lennar - Pluses and Minuses

  • Wilbert C.
  • Verified HomeBuyer
  • July 10, 2019
  • Thornton, CO

Make sure as a new buyer you are present for the final walkthrough and customer orientation. Purchasing our home from out of town meant we missed both and were behind the eight ball from the start. Quality seems pretty good, workmanship and cleanup left something to be desired. Follow-up for warranty issues needs to be improved.

Mid-level build quality at high-level price point

  • Anonymous
  • Verified HomeBuyer
  • November 22, 2024
  • Arvada, CO

Life circumstances required a home purchase in a short time frame. I did not see or experience the building phase, it was finished the first time I saw it. Final walk-through revealed multiple issues if varying severity, but none critical (mostly fit/finish, but not all). Walk-thru to close was 1 week, not all fixes made, was told to submit warranty requests for unaddressed items. Frustration: repairs that have been made were made to the lowest possible quality to still qualify as 'repaired' instead of genuinely done well.
